一、磁盘分区 挂载

1、windows下的系统分区

未命名图片.png

2、linux分区

  • Linux来说无论有几个分区,分给哪个目录使用,他归根结底就只有一个目录,一个独立且唯一的文件结构,linux中每个分区都是用来组成整个文件系统的一部分。
  • linux采用了一种叫“载入”的处理方法,他的整个文件系统包含了一整套的文件和目录,且将一个分区和一个目录联系起来。这时要载入的一个分区将时他的存储空间在一个目录下获得

    2.1查看linux的分区

    lsblk -f 【老师不离开】 【不带-f可以查看各个分区的大小】
    未命名图片.png
    经典的挂载案例
    如何增加一块硬盘
  1. 虚拟机添加硬盘
  2. 分区
  3. 格式化
  4. 挂载
  5. 可以设置自动挂载

    3、磁盘相关查询

    3.1 查询系统整体磁盘使用情况

    基本语法 **df -h**

    3.2 查询指定目录的磁盘占用情况

    基本语法 **du -h /目录**
    查询指定目录的此判占用情况,默认为当前目录
-s 指定目录占用大小汇总
-h 带计量单位
-a 含文件
—max-depth=1 子目录深度
-c 列出明细的同时,增加汇总值

应用实例:
查询/opt目录的磁盘占用情况,深度为1
**du -ach --max-depth=1 /opt**

3.3 磁盘情况-工作实用指令

  • 统计/home文件夹下文件的个数

**ls -l /home | grep "^-"| wc -l**

  • 统计/home文件夹下目录的个数

**ls -l /home | grep "^d" | wc -l**

  • 统计/home文件夹下文件的个数,包括子文件夹里的

**ls -lR /home | grep "^-" | wc -l**

  • 统计文件夹下目录的个数,包括子文件夹里的

**ls -lR /home | grep "^d" | wc -l**

  • 以树状显示目录结构

yum install tree
tree

二、网络配置

  • 目前linux的ip是一个动态ip,不是静态的
  • 因此不能满足开发的需求
  • 网络配置原理图

未命名图片.png

1、查看网络IP和网关

  • 查看网络编辑器
    • 在vm中左上角查看虚拟网络编辑器
  • 修改IP地址(修改虚拟网卡的IP)

未命名图片.png
未命名图片.png

2、ping测试主机之间网络连通性

基本语法: ping 目的主机 (测试当前服务器是否可以连接目的主机)

3、linux网络环境配置

第一种方法(自动获取)

  • 说明:登陆后,通过界面的设置自动获取ip
  • 特点:linux启动后会自动获取ip,缺点是每次自动获取的ip地址可能不一样
  • 不适用于做服务器(服务器ip是固定的,不能变)


    第二种方法(修改配置文件指定ip)

  • 直接修改配置文件来指定ip,并且可以连接到外网(程序员推荐)

  • 编辑 vi /etc/sysconfig/network-scripts/ifcfg-eth0
  • 编辑完成之后重启服务service network restart

未命名图片.png